What are Conex Containers?
Conex containers are standardized metal containers used for transferring products. Initially created for shipping by sea, these containers are now extensively used for storage, momentary housing, and even ingenious architectural tasks. The term "Conex" stemmed from the term "container express," which encapsulated the essence of expedited Shipping Container Architecture.

The history of Conex containers go back to the early 1950s. The intro of the ISO standardization permitted for intermodal transport, assisting in smooth cargo motion by rail, roadway, and sea. The standardization likewise guaranteed sturdiness and security, making them perfect for long-distance journeys. Over the decades, the design and structure have actually developed to incorporate contemporary facilities, including insulation for temperature-sensitive goods and built-in RFID technology for tracking deliveries.

Conex containers present many advantages across different applications:
Durability and Strength
Built from top quality steel, these containers are developed to withstand extreme weather condition conditions and are resistant to deterioration.
Cost-Effectiveness
Compared to traditional construction approaches or storage facilities, Conex containers are an economical choice. Their availability in the used market can considerably reduce costs.
Customizability
Containers can be modified to suit particular needs, consisting of the addition of windows, doors, electrical systems, and HVAC units.
Movement
Quickly portable, they can be moved utilizing trucks or cranes, making them an ideal option for moving work environments or short-term setups.
Security
Lockable and tough in nature, Conex containers provide an added layer of security for important products.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Just how much do Conex containers cost?
The cost of a Conex container differs widely based on size, condition (new vs. used), and modifications. Typically, used containers can range from ₤ 1,500 to ₤ 3,500, while new containers might cost in between ₤ 3,000 and ₤ 5,000.
2. Do Conex containers need authorizations for setup?
It depends upon local regulations. Many towns need licenses for container use, specifically if they are modified or used for domestic functions. Constantly inspect regional zoning laws.
3. What is the lifespan of a Conex container?
A well-kept Conex container can last between 10 to 25 years, depending upon ecological conditions and use.
4. Can Conex containers be insulated?
Yes, containers can be insulated to ensure warmth in cooler environments or to manage temperature-sensitive product. Expert insulation approaches exist to preserve structural integrity.
5. Are Conex containers ecologically friendly?
Yes, repurposing Conex containers for various usages can decrease waste and lower the carbon footprint connected with conventional construction methods.
6. How do I pick the best size Conex container?
Think about the designated use, storage requirements, and offered area. Requirement sizes include 20-foot and 40-foot containers, but there are multiple sizes readily available to meet different requirements.
